Hematology
The landmark Hematology trials every internist should be able to quote — 30 studies across 6 evidence panels, each linked to its primary paper with a brief, plain-language summary of what it showed and why it changed practice.
Panel 1 — Anemia & Transfusion: Foundations
- TRICC1999
RCT of 838 euvolemic critically ill adults comparing a restrictive transfusion strategy (transfuse at Hb <7 g/dL, target 7–9) versus a liberal strategy (transfuse at Hb <10 g/dL, target 10–12). 30-day mortality was not significantly different overall (18.7% restrictive vs 23.3% liberal, p=0.11) and was significantly lower with the restrictive strategy in younger and less acutely ill patients. In-hospital mortality favored restriction. Takeaway: a restrictive threshold (Hb 7 g/dL) is at least as safe as a liberal one in most stable critically ill adults — the foundational transfusion-threshold trial and a perennial board favorite.
- TRISS2014
Multicenter RCT of 998 ICU patients with septic shock comparing a transfusion threshold of Hb ≤7 g/dL versus ≤9 g/dL. 90-day mortality was nearly identical (43.0% vs 45.0%; RR 0.94, p=0.44), with no difference in ischemic events or use of life support, while the lower-threshold group received about half as many transfusions. Takeaway: in septic shock, a restrictive Hb 7 g/dL threshold gives similar outcomes to a liberal 9 g/dL threshold while using fewer units — extends TRICC's restrictive principle into sepsis. Neutral (non-inferiority-type) result.
- CHOIR2006
RCT of 1,432 non-dialysis CKD patients with anemia randomized to a higher hemoglobin target (13.5 g/dL) versus a lower target (11.3 g/dL) using epoetin alfa. The higher-target group had a significantly increased risk of the composite of death, MI, heart failure hospitalization, and stroke (HR 1.34, p=0.03) with no improvement in quality of life. Takeaway: targeting near-normal hemoglobin with ESAs in CKD causes harm — anchors the "don't fully normalize Hb with ESAs" board pearl.
- TREAT2009
Placebo-controlled RCT of 4,038 patients with type 2 diabetes, CKD, and anemia; darbepoetin alfa targeted Hb ~13 g/dL versus placebo (rescue only). Darbepoetin did not reduce the primary composite of death or cardiovascular events, nor death or renal events, and it roughly doubled the risk of fatal or nonfatal stroke (HR 1.92, p<0.001) while modestly reducing transfusions. Takeaway: ESA therapy to normalize Hb in diabetic CKD offers no cardiorenal benefit and increases stroke risk — reinforces selective, conservative ESA use.
Panel 2 — Coagulation / VTE / Cancer-Associated Thrombosis
- CLOT2003
RCT of 672 cancer patients with acute VTE comparing dalteparin (LMWH) for 6 months versus dalteparin bridge to an oral coumarin (warfarin). Dalteparin reduced recurrent VTE from 17% to 9% (HR 0.48, p=0.002) without increasing major bleeding. Takeaway: established LMWH as the standard for cancer-associated thrombosis for over a decade and the comparator against which later DOAC trials were judged.
- HOKUSAI VTE CANCER2018
Randomized open-label noninferiority trial of 1,050 cancer patients with VTE comparing oral edoxaban (after ≥5 days LMWH) versus subcutaneous dalteparin. Edoxaban was noninferior for the composite of recurrent VTE or major bleeding (12.8% vs 13.5%, HR 0.97). Recurrent VTE was numerically lower with edoxaban, but major bleeding was significantly higher (6.9% vs 4.0%), driven largely by upper-GI bleeds in GI-cancer patients. Takeaway: DOACs are effective for cancer VTE but carry higher GI bleeding risk, especially with GI malignancies.
- SELECT-D2018
Randomized pilot trial (n=406) of cancer patients with VTE comparing rivaroxaban versus dalteparin for 6 months. Rivaroxaban reduced 6-month recurrent VTE (4% vs 11%; HR 0.43) but increased clinically relevant non-major bleeding (13% vs 4%) with a numerical rise in major bleeding. Takeaway: rivaroxaban lowers recurrence at the cost of more (particularly GI/GU) bleeding — echoes the DOAC efficacy/bleeding trade-off in cancer-associated thrombosis.
- CARAVAGGIO2020
Randomized open-label noninferiority trial of 1,170 cancer patients with VTE comparing oral apixaban versus subcutaneous dalteparin for 6 months. Apixaban was noninferior for recurrent VTE (5.6% vs 7.9%, HR 0.63) with no excess major bleeding (3.8% vs 4.0%) and — unlike edoxaban/rivaroxaban — no significant increase in GI bleeding. Takeaway: apixaban is an effective oral option for cancer-associated VTE without the bleeding penalty seen with other DOACs, broadening acceptable DOAC use.
- AMPLIFY2013
Double-blind RCT of 5,395 patients with acute VTE comparing apixaban monotherapy versus enoxaparin-to-warfarin. Apixaban was noninferior for recurrent VTE or VTE-related death (2.3% vs 2.7%, RR 0.84) and significantly reduced major bleeding (0.6% vs 1.8%; RR 0.31, p<0.001). Takeaway: apixaban is as effective as conventional anticoagulation for acute VTE with markedly less major bleeding — a pivotal DOAC trial for the general (non-cancer) VTE population.
Panel 3 — Sickle Cell Disease & Thalassemia
- MSH1995
Placebo-controlled RCT of 299 adults with moderate-to-severe sickle cell anemia (≥3 crises/year). Hydroxyurea reduced the median annual rate of painful crises (2.5 vs 4.5), roughly halved episodes of acute chest syndrome, and reduced transfusions and hospitalizations. Takeaway: the trial that established hydroxyurea as disease-modifying therapy and the backbone of sickle cell disease management.
- BABY HUG2011
Placebo-controlled RCT of 193 infants (9–18 months) with sickle cell anemia treated with hydroxyurea for 2 years, regardless of severity. The co-primary endpoints (spleen and kidney function) were not significantly improved, but hydroxyurea significantly reduced pain crises and dactylitis, with supportive trends toward fewer acute chest syndrome episodes, hospitalizations, and transfusions, and acceptable toxicity. Takeaway: supports safe, effective early hydroxyurea use in very young children — expanded use into infancy despite neutral organ-function endpoints.
- SUSTAIN2017
Phase 2 placebo-controlled RCT of 198 sickle cell patients comparing the anti–P-selectin antibody crizanlizumab (high dose 5 mg/kg) versus placebo. High-dose crizanlizumab lowered the median annual rate of vaso-occlusive crises by ~45% (1.63 vs 2.98, p=0.01) and increased the proportion of crisis-free patients, with a favorable safety profile. Takeaway: introduced targeted anti-adhesion therapy as an adjunct to reduce pain crises in sickle cell disease.
- HOPE2019
Phase 3 placebo-controlled RCT of 274 sickle cell patients comparing the hemoglobin-oxygen affinity modulator voxelotor (1500 mg) versus placebo. At 24 weeks, 51% of the 1500-mg group achieved a hemoglobin increase >1 g/dL versus 7% with placebo (p<0.001), with reduced hemolysis markers. The trial was not powered to show a reduction in vaso-occlusive crises. Takeaway: voxelotor durably raises hemoglobin by inhibiting HbS polymerization — a hemoglobin/hemolysis-directed agent (note: voxelotor was later withdrawn from the market in 2024 over safety signals; the HOPE efficacy result stands).
- BELIEVE2020
Phase 3 placebo-controlled RCT of 336 adults with transfusion-dependent β-thalassemia comparing the erythroid-maturation agent luspatercept versus placebo. Significantly more luspatercept patients achieved ≥33% reduction in transfusion burden over weeks 13–24 (21.4% vs 4.5%, p<0.001). Takeaway: luspatercept reduces transfusion requirements in transfusion-dependent β-thalassemia — a novel mechanism distinct from ESAs.
Panel 4 — Myeloproliferative Neoplasms: PV / ET / MF
- ECLAP2004
Double-blind placebo-controlled RCT of 518 polycythemia vera patients (no clear indication for/contraindication to aspirin) comparing low-dose aspirin (100 mg/day) versus placebo. Aspirin reduced the primary composite of nonfatal MI, nonfatal stroke, PE, major venous thrombosis, or cardiovascular death (RR 0.40, p=0.03) without a significant increase in major bleeding. Takeaway: established low-dose aspirin as standard thromboprophylaxis in PV unless contraindicated.
- CYTO-PV2013
RCT of 365 PV patients randomized to a hematocrit target of <45% versus 45–50%. The lower-hematocrit group had a significantly reduced rate of cardiovascular death or major thrombosis (2.7% vs 9.8%; HR 3.91 for the higher target, p=0.007). Takeaway: provided the evidence for the <45% hematocrit target central to PV management.
- RESPONSE2015
Phase 3 RCT of 222 PV patients resistant to or intolerant of hydroxyurea comparing the JAK1/2 inhibitor ruxolitinib versus best available therapy. Ruxolitinib achieved the composite of hematocrit control plus ≥35% spleen-volume reduction far more often (21% vs 1%, p<0.001) and improved disease-related symptoms. Takeaway: ruxolitinib is effective second-line therapy for hydroxyurea-resistant/intolerant PV.
- COMFORT-I2012
Phase 3 placebo-controlled RCT of 309 patients with intermediate-2 or high-risk myelofibrosis comparing ruxolitinib versus placebo. Significantly more ruxolitinib patients achieved ≥35% reduction in spleen volume at 24 weeks (41.9% vs 0.7%, p<0.001) with substantial improvement in symptom burden and quality of life. Takeaway: first JAK inhibitor approved for myelofibrosis — established ruxolitinib for splenomegaly and constitutional symptoms.
- PROUD-PV / CONTINUATION-PV2020
Randomized phase 3 noninferiority trial (PROUD-PV, n=257) with open-label extension (CONTINUATION-PV) comparing ropeginterferon alfa-2b versus hydroxyurea/best available therapy in PV. Ropeginterferon did NOT meet the pre-specified composite noninferiority endpoint at 12 months (21% vs 28%), but by 36 months showed higher durable complete hematologic response with disease-modification (JAK2 allele-burden reduction). Takeaway: supports ropeginterferon as durable, disease-modifying cytoreduction in PV, especially for long-term control.
Panel 5 — CLL & Lymphoid Malignancies
- RESONATE-22015
Phase 3 RCT of 269 previously untreated CLL/SLL patients aged ≥65 comparing the BTK inhibitor ibrutinib versus chlorambucil. Ibrutinib significantly prolonged progression-free survival (median not reached vs 18.9 months; HR 0.16) and overall survival (24-month OS 98% vs 85%) with higher response rates. Takeaway: established BTK inhibition as a chemotherapy-free frontline option for older untreated CLL.
- CLL142019
Phase 3 RCT of 432 previously untreated CLL patients with coexisting conditions comparing fixed-duration venetoclax + obinutuzumab versus chlorambucil + obinutuzumab. The venetoclax arm significantly improved progression-free survival (24-month PFS 88.2% vs 64.1%; HR 0.35) with higher rates of undetectable minimal residual disease. Takeaway: established time-limited BCL2-inhibitor–based therapy as a frontline standard for CLL.
- MURANO2018
Phase 3 RCT of 389 patients with relapsed/refractory CLL comparing fixed-duration venetoclax + rituximab versus bendamustine + rituximab. Venetoclax-rituximab markedly improved 2-year progression-free survival (84.9% vs 36.3%; HR 0.17, p<0.001) with higher undetectable-MRD rates. Takeaway: established chemo-free, time-limited venetoclax-based therapy in the relapsed/refractory CLL setting.
- ELEVATE-TN2020
Three-arm phase 3 RCT of 535 treatment-naive CLL patients comparing acalabrutinib + obinutuzumab, acalabrutinib monotherapy, and chlorambucil + obinutuzumab. Both acalabrutinib arms significantly prolonged progression-free survival versus chemoimmunotherapy (estimated 24-month PFS 93% and 87% vs 47%). Takeaway: supports the second-generation BTK inhibitor acalabrutinib as effective, well-tolerated frontline CLL therapy.
- ZUMA-12017
Single-arm phase 2 trial of 101 patients with refractory large B-cell lymphoma treated with the anti-CD19 CAR T-cell product axicabtagene ciloleucel. The objective response rate was 82% with a 54% complete response rate; ~40% remained in ongoing response at ~15 months. Grade ≥3 cytokine release syndrome (13%) and neurologic events (28%) were notable. Takeaway: a pivotal CAR T-cell trial establishing durable responses in otherwise refractory aggressive B-cell lymphoma.
Panel 6 — Myeloma & Acute Leukemia: Rapid Pearls
- SWOG S07772017
Phase 3 RCT of 525 newly diagnosed myeloma patients (no immediate transplant intent) comparing triplet VRd (bortezomib + lenalidomide + dexamethasone) versus doublet Rd. VRd significantly improved progression-free survival (median 43 vs 30 months; HR 0.71) and overall survival (median 75 vs 64 months). Takeaway: established the VRd triplet as a frontline standard over lenalidomide-dexamethasone alone.
- MAIA2019
Phase 3 RCT of 737 transplant-ineligible newly diagnosed myeloma patients comparing daratumumab + lenalidomide + dexamethasone (D-Rd) versus Rd. Adding daratumumab reduced progression or death (30-month PFS 71% vs 56%; HR 0.56, p<0.001) with deeper responses and higher MRD-negativity. Takeaway: established the anti-CD38 antibody daratumumab in frontline therapy for transplant-ineligible myeloma.
- IFM 2009 / DETERMINATION2017 / 2022
Two linked phase 3 RCTs testing early autologous stem-cell transplant with VRd induction versus VRd alone (with transplant reserved) in newly diagnosed myeloma. IFM 2009 (n=700): early transplant improved progression-free survival (median 50 vs 36 months; HR 0.65) but showed no overall-survival difference. DETERMINATION (n=722), the US counterpart with lenalidomide maintenance until progression, confirmed a large PFS benefit with transplant (median 67.5 vs 46.2 months; HR 1.53 for RVd-alone vs transplant, i.e. ~0.65 favoring transplant) but again no overall-survival difference. Takeaway: early autologous transplant deepens response and prolongs PFS, but has not shown an OS advantage in the modern novel-agent era — transplant timing remains individualized.
- RATIFY2017
Phase 3 placebo-controlled RCT (CALGB 10603/RATIFY) of 717 adults (18–59) with FLT3-mutated AML adding the multi-kinase/FLT3 inhibitor midostaurin to standard 7+3 induction and consolidation. Midostaurin significantly improved overall survival (median 74.7 vs 25.6 months; HR 0.78, p=0.009) and event-free survival. Takeaway: established FLT3-targeted therapy added to chemotherapy as standard for FLT3-mutated AML — a key example of molecular profiling guiding AML treatment.
- VIALE-A2020
Phase 3 placebo-controlled RCT of 431 previously untreated AML patients ineligible for intensive chemotherapy comparing azacitidine + venetoclax versus azacitidine + placebo. The combination improved median overall survival (14.7 vs 9.6 months; HR 0.66, p<0.001) and composite complete remission (66% vs 28%). Takeaway: established azacitidine + venetoclax as the standard of care for older/unfit AML patients.
- APL04062013
Phase 3 noninferiority RCT of 162 patients with low-to-intermediate-risk acute promyelocytic leukemia comparing ATRA + arsenic trioxide (chemotherapy-free) versus ATRA + idarubicin chemotherapy. The ATRA-ATO arm was noninferior and superior: 2-year event-free survival 97% vs 86% and overall survival 99% vs 91%, with less hematologic toxicity. Takeaway: established a chemotherapy-free ATRA + arsenic trioxide regimen as standard for non-high-risk APL. (Board pearl: APL is an emergency — start ATRA promptly when suspected.)
